March 2007
Jeffrey
Morgan's (Fallon Paiute) debut documentary film Lillie
& Leander: A Legacy of Violence premieres in the 2007
Tribeca Film Festival. The Tribeca premiere is co-presented by
NMAI. In 2005, Lillie & Leander was one of 29 projects
selected by Tribeca All Access, a program dedicated to the professional
development of independent minority filmmakers. Morgan works as
a producer and in-house director at Deutsch Advertising in New
York. He produces national radio and television commercials for
Westin, IKEA, Revlon, Monster.com, and Snapple. His first national
television campaign as producer, Westin Hotel's This Is How
It Should Feel, debuted during the 2006 Super Bowl. He won
the Deutsch Advertising annual short films talent show from 2004
- 2006. Morgan received a BA in Film and Television Production
from the Kanbar Institute at New York University, where he was
recognized as a Founder's Day Scholar for his academic excellence.
Born in Artesia, California, and raised in Juneau, Alaska, Morgan
made fifteen short films before completing high school.
